Enjoy another day of sunshine today. Temperatures warm from the mid 30s this morning to the upper 40s this afternoon. Wind becomes northerly this evening, which will drop temperatures overnight and to end the week. We’ll continue to see plenty of sunshine Thursday and Friday with highs in the low 40s.
Make plans to get outdoors over the weekend – it looks absolutely gorgeous! Mostly sunny with highs rebounding into the mid 40s Saturday then 50s Sunday.
The forecast stays mostly dry. There is a chance for an isolated shower or two Monday, but most rain holds off until Tuesday overnight into next Wednesday.
Today: Mostly sunny. High 48.
Tonight: Partly cloudy. Low 26.
Thursday: Sunny. High 40.
Friday: Sunny. High 42.
